Historic Victorian Boutique Inn Steps from Downtown Kingston

Accommodations & Grounds

Hochelaga Inn offers a collection of distinct rooms, including the Sydenham Tower Suite with 360° views and the Library Suite. The property is set within well-maintained gardens, with outdoor seating areas on the terrace and front porch. Each room has a private bathroom and air conditioning, with the main Victorian building showcasing original high ceilings and woodwork.

Dining & Breakfast

A complimentary daily breakfast made with local ingredients is served in the dining room. Guests also have access to coffee and tea throughout the day in the shared lounge area. A hot breakfast is available for an extra charge.

Location

The inn is within a 5-minute walk of downtown Kingston shopping and dining. Queen's University is 400 metres away, and the shoreline of Lake Ontario is also a short walk from the property. This central location places guests close to historic sites and the waterfront.

Amenities & Services

The hotel provides free Wi-Fi throughout the building and free on-site parking across the street. Daily housekeeping is available, and the 24-hour front desk offers invoice provide and assistance. Well-behaved pets are welcome under the hotel's pet-friendly accommodations policy.

Guest Experience & Facilities

Board games and puzzles are available for guests in the shared lounge. The property offers outdoor furniture, a sun terrace, and a garden for relaxation. Each room is heated and has window air conditioning, with the cottage rooms providing additional privacy.

About Hochelaga Inn
How many guests can be accommodated in the Inn, and are there options for connecting rooms?
15 January 2024
The Hochelaga Inn features 21 uniquely furnished rooms, with several options available for connecting rooms to suit various travel needs.
What are the current public health measures in Kingston, and will breakfast still be served?
20 February 2024
Kingston mandates indoor mask-wearing and maintaining a distance of 2 meters. A full hot-plated breakfast is still being offered, although buffet service has been suspended.
Is there parking available on the premises or should guests look for street parking?
10 March 2024
The Inn has 9 parking spots available on a first-come, first-served basis. Additional free overnight and weekend parking options are located across the street, along with on-street parking.
What accommodations are available for a family of four, comprising two adults and two teenagers?
25 April 2024
The Frontenac Cottage or the Innkeeper Suite are recommended for a family of four. The Cottage features 2 double beds and 1 single bed, while the Innkeeper Suite has a queen bed and a double pull-out couch.
Can guests expect a diverse breakfast menu during their stay?
12 May 2024
Yes, the breakfast menu changes daily, featuring a range of options including egg-based dishes, sweet selections like pancakes or French toast, and a variety of sides to ensure guests enjoy a balanced meal each morning.
Is there on-site parking available, and what are the alternatives for guests?
30 June 2024
There is limited free parking on-site; further, other free and paid parking options are conveniently available within the surrounding area.
Is luggage storage offered for non-guests visiting Kingston?
15 July 2024
Unfortunately, luggage storage is not available for individuals who are not staying at the Inn.
Is the Inn wheelchair accessible?
18 August 2024
This property is not wheelchair accessible, as it is a heritage building with several steps. Assistance can be provided for guests who need help entering.
What is the deposit policy for reservations at the Inn?
5 September 2024
No deposit is taken; only a credit card is needed to secure the reservation, with no charges incurred until check-in. Cancellations made at least 72 hours prior incur no fees.
Are bathrooms private in the guest rooms?
12 October 2024
Yes, each room is equipped with its own private bathroom for guest comfort and convenience.
Is it possible to accommodate a well-behaved dog during a stay?
22 November 2024
Pets are occasionally welcome at the Inn, particularly small, quiet ones, though it's advisable to contact in advance to discuss any pet-related policies.
What time can guests enjoy breakfast at the Inn?
6 December 2024
Breakfast is served daily from 07:30 to 10:00.
